33. Which of the following is used as a rocket fuel? A. H2SO4 B. HCl C. HNO3 D. CH3COOH

  • A. H2SO4
  • B. HCl
  • C. HNO3Correct
  • D. CH3COOH

Explanation

Trioxonitrate (V) acid (HNO3) is very useful; it is also used as a rocket fuel and in the production of dyes, explosives, and fertilizers.
